What You'll Need to Draw Christmas Tree

  • Pencil (HB or #2)
  • Eraser
  • Drawing paper or sketchbook
  • Colored pencils, crayons, or markers
  • Black marker or pen (for outlines)

Tips for Drawing Christmas Tree

  • Start with light pencil strokes so you can easily erase mistakes
  • Break Christmas Tree into simple shapes like circles, ovals, and rectangles
  • Take your time with each step - there's no rush!
  • Add your own creative details to make your Christmas Tree unique
  • Practice makes perfect - try drawing Christmas Tree a few times
